Giuseppe Tito Aronica
Giuseppe T Aronica is Full Professor of Flood Risk Management and Hydraulic Engineering at Dept. of Engineering, University of Messina from January 2018. He is graduated (M.Sc. in Hydraulic Engineering) from University of Palermo (Italy) in 1991. He holds a Ph.D. in Hydraulic Engineering from University of Naples (Italy).
He was visiting researcher at School of Geographical Sciences, University of Bristol (UK), Department of Environmental Science, Lancaster University (UK) and he has been Visiting Professor (2018) at Centre for Water Systems – University of Exeter (UK).
Research activities of Prof. Giuseppe T Aronica are related to flood risk management and flood defence design, flood vulnerability and damage evaluation, pluvial flooding, sustainable urban drainage systems, flood early warning flood propagation modelling, flash floods and debris flows.
He is currently Principal Investigator of many several national and international Research Project on the following topics: pluvial flooding, sustainable urban drainage systems, flood risk management and flood defence design.
Prof. Giuseppe T Aronica is author and co-author of more than 130 papers published in referred Italian and International scientific journals and symposium proceedings (SCOPUS metrics: 71 documents by author, 4162 citations, 28 H-index, Google Scholar: 6135 citations, 31 H-index).
He is Member of the editorial board of the Journal of Flood Risk Management, Water journal, European Water journal and Frontiers in Hydrosphere. He is Coordinator of the IAHR (International Association for Hydraulic Research) Urban Flood Modelling and Risk Management Working Group (UFMRM WG)
